Bitcoin is flashing one of technical analysis's oldest bullish signals, even as the market takes a breather. While BTC is trading at $78,543.27, down 0.83% over 24 hours, and Ethereum sits at $2,485.47, down 0.19%, there's a signal hidden beneath the muted daily moves. As CoinDesk points out, Bitcoin's 50-day simple moving average has now crossed above its 200-day average – the pattern traders call a golden cross. Why does anyone care? Moving averages smooth out the noise. When the average Bitcoin price over the past 50 days surpasses the much slower 200-day trend, it indicates that recent strength has become substantial enough to alter the longer-term picture. The signal is backward-looking rather than predictive, but generations of traders have watched the same 50/200-day crossover across stocks, commodities, and eventually crypto. Bitcoin's own record is encouraging without being perfect – CoinDesk found 12 previous golden crosses since 2012. Across the nine months for which a three-month return could be measured, BTC gained an average of 24.9%. Only three survived for a full year without being reversed by a death cross, but those three produced extraordinary returns. There is another potentially bullish piece of the puzzle: USDT's share of the total crypto market has been moving toward a bearish 'death cross' of its own – falling stablecoin dominance can indicate that more of the market's value is moving into Bitcoin and altcoins rather than sitting in dollar-pegged assets.
